Time Capsule: 1972

News & Economy

President: Richard M. Nixon
Vice President: Spiro T. Agnew

Population: 209,896,021
Life expectancy: 71.2 years

Dow-Jones High: 1036
Dow-Jones Low: 921

Cost of a new home: $30,500.00
Cost of a new car: $--
Median Household Income: $9,697.00
Cost of a first-class stamp: $0.10
Cost of a gallon of gas: $0.36
Cost of a dozen eggs: $0.52
Cost of a gallon of milk: $1.20

News Headlines

Governor Wallace Is Shot In Laurel MD. And Paralyzed  

Nixon And Brezhnev Sign Two SALT Agreements 

11 Israelis Are Killed By Palestinian Terrorists At Munich Olympics 

Beak-In At Democratic Headquarters In Watergate Towers, Five Caught 

Nixon Wins by A Landslide 47 Million To 29 Million 

Washington Post Connects Watergate With Committee To Elect Nixon 

Kissinger Secretly Negotiating With North Vietnamese In Paris
